Summary: | PURPOSE:To form a sheet that is free from bubble traces and is excellent in flatness, by bringing an extruded thermoplastic resin film in firm contact with a cooling roll under pressure by a static electricity application method. CONSTITUTION:A thermoplastic resin is made in the melted state, and is extruded from a mouthpiece 2 having a slit into a film 10. Then it is cooled on a cooling roll 6 to be solidified. During the period from the extrusion to the cooling and solidification, the film is exposed to a pressurized atmosphere in the pressurized chamber 4 that is at or over a gauge pressure of 0.2kg w/cm . The cooling roll 6 is electrically insulated from the earth, the pressurized chamber 4 and the mouthpiece 2, and a high voltage is applied onto the surface of the cooling roll 6 with which the film is brought in firm contact to be cooled. Then the cooled and solidified film is led by nip rolling rubber rolls 9 from the pressurized chamber 4 and is taken out as a film 11. |
